Omega Phi Alpha, a service sorority at Georgia Southern University, is at the Russell Union from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. this week selling Thread of Hope Bracelets for $2. These bracelets are made by women in the Philippines to provide a source of income to for their families. These women make these bracelets to avoid the pressures of sex trafficking.

Jessica Allen, a pledge of Omega Phi Alpha, encourages students to support this cause by coming out, buying a bracelet and sharing the stories behind them to inspire others to get involved as well. If you would like more information about Threads of Hope, go to www.threadsofhope.com.ph.
